China's new high-altitude, high-speed, long-endurance unmanned aerial vehicle CH-7 (or Caihong-7, meaning Rainbow-7) has successfully completed its maiden flight, marking a key milestone in the program. The aircraft previously made a public appearance at the 15th China International Aviation and Aerospace Exhibition in 2024.
The CH-7 features an advanced high-aspect-ratio flying-wing aerodynamic design. It is capable of carrying multiple high-performance mission payloads, including electro-optical and infrared systems.

With advantages such as long endurance, high service ceiling, fast cruise speed and strong mission capability, the vehicle is designed to meet advanced requirements for ground observation, data support and other tasks under complex conditions.
Follow-on tests are expected to focus on expanding the flight performance envelope and verifying payload functions.
